If you had read the front-page story of the San Francisco Chronicle many years ago, you would have read about a female Humpback Whale which had become entangled in a spider web of crab traps and lines. She was weighed down by hundreds of pounds of traps that caused her to struggle to stay afloat. She also had hundreds of yards of line rope wrapped around her body, her tail, her torso, a line tugging in her mouth.

A fisherman spotted her just east of the Farallon Islands (outside the Golden Gate) and radioed an environment group for help.

Within a few hours, the rescue team arrived and determined that she was so badly off the only way to save her was to dive in and untangle her. They worked for hours with curved knives and eventually freed her.

She then came back to each diver, one at a time, and nudged them, pushed them gently around … she was thanking them. Some said that it was the most incredibly beautiful experience of their lives. The person who cut the rope out of her mouth said her eyes were following him the whole time, and he will never be the same.

In England, an ordinary person is called the commoner. There are billions of commoners the world over.

Let me introduce you to a commoner in our society. Her mythical name is “Molly SeeNoGood.”

She wakes up tired every day; life is taking its toll. She is critical of everything. Most of her communications with others has sunk to the depths of negativity. Criticizing has become a way of life for Ms. SeeNoGood. She could not perceive good if it stared her directly in the face, because she wears bitter sunglasses that color everything in the dark shades of the hellish life she has created for herself. She blames everyone and everything outside of herself for her bad life; but what happens to her has very little to do with events. Molly has not said “thank you” in years, and Molly is drowning in her self-created darkness. Molly does not live life; she simply exists in a day-to-day existence, marking time by the events of crises.

Everyone knows someone like Molly who is living a common life. It was sad in Jesus’ day, and it is equally sad today.

Let’s visit next with an un-commoner: a person who rises above mediocrity to a new level of living. His name is “Seymour Good.”

He no longer allows outer events to rob him of his daily life, and he has a giving, thankful attitude. He is an adventurer who goes into each day with an expectation of good. He always wears the garment of a smile. It is the main staple of his wardrobe, and he gives it fully to any, and all. His smile is just an outer expression of his inner-perception of life; he sees good everywhere, in everyone, and in everything. He gives thanks to God, constantly.
